CONSISTS OF: Two different pressure chambers such as shell side and tube side. Two different fluids run through each chamber without mix. If there is a temperature difference between them, it is possible exchange heat without mixing the fluids.
This equipment is suitable for high and low pressures, high and low temperatures and even for corrosive and non-corrosive fluids, and their high velocities are better for heat transfer. A greater temperature difference causes a greater rate of heat transfer.
These exchangers can be used for practically any exchange between two fluids, including those with phase changes.
In general, they are composed of cylindrical tubes, inside of it there is a bundle, and the axis of the tubes which composed of this bundle is parallel to the axis of the shell.
